&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Hingalganj (Vidhan Sabha constituency)&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; is an [[Vidhan Sabha|assembly]] constituency in [[North 24 Parganas district]] in the [[India]]n [[States and territories of India|state]] of [[West Bengal]]. It is reserved for [[Scheduled castes and scheduled tribes|scheduled castes]].&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==Overview==&lt;br /&gt;
As per orders of the [[Delimitation Commission of India|Delimitation Commission]], 126 Hingalganj (Vidhan Sabha constituency) (SC) is composed of the following: [[Hingalganj]] [[Community Development Block in India|community development block]], and Barunhat Rameshwarpur, Bhabanipur I, Bhabanipur II, Hasnabad, PatliKhanpur [[gram panchayat]]s of [[Hasnabad (community development block)|Hasnabad]] community development block, and Khulna gram panchayat of [[Sandeshkhali II]] community development block.&amp;lt;ref name=delimitation&amp;gt;{{cite web| url = http://eci.nic.in/delim/Final_Publications/WestBengal/FINAL%20ORDER%20NOTIFICATION_English.pdf | title = Delimitation Commission Order No. 18 dated 15 February 2006 | access-date= 15 October 2010 |work = West Bengal | publisher= Election Commission of India}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Hingalganj (Vidhan Sabha constituency) is part of 18. [[Basirhat (Lok Sabha constituency)]].&amp;lt;ref name=delimitation/&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;

===1977-2006===&lt;br /&gt;
In the [[2006 West Bengal state assembly election|2006 assembly elections]],&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ha2006/&amp;gt; Gopal Gayen of [[Communist Party of India (Marxist)|CPI(M)]] won the 99 Hingalganj (SC) assembly seat defeating his nearest rival Debes Mandal of [[All India Trinamool Congress|Trinamool Congress]]. Contests in most years were multi cornered but only winners and runners are being mentioned. Nripen Gayen of CPI(M) defeated Sourendra Mondal of Trinamool Congress in 2001,&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ha2001/&amp;gt; Bidyut Kayal of [[Indian National Congress|Congress]] in 1996&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1996/&amp;gt; and Sankar Roy of Congress in 1991.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1991/&amp;gt; Sudhanshu Mondal of CPI(M) defeated Aditya Mondal of Congress in 1987&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1987/&amp;gt; and Amal Krishna Mistry representing Congress in 1982&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1982/&amp;gt; and representing [[Janata Party]] in 1977.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1977/&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ref&amp;gt;{{cite web| url = http://eci.nic.in/archive/ElectionAnalysis/AE/S25/Partycomp99.htm |title =99 - Hingalganj (SC) Assembly Constituency |work = Partywise Comparison Since 1977 | publisher = Election Commission of India|access-date = 15 October 2010}}&amp;lt;/ref&amp;gt;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===1967-1972===&lt;br /&gt;
Anil Chandra Mondal of [[Communist Party of India|CPI]] won in 1972.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1972/&amp;gt; Gopal Chandra Gayen of CPI(M) won in 1971.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1971/&amp;gt;  Hazari Lal Mondal of CPI won in 1969.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1969/&amp;gt; B.N. Brahmachari of Independent won in 1967.&amp;lt;ref name=vidhansabha1967/&amp;gt; Prior to that the Hingalganj seat was not there.&lt;br /&gt;
